Idle to 3500rpm Running Very Rough above 3500 Normal
Ok i've done a few searches but nothing nails it. Most have been blown engines that have similar symptoms.Car is FC turbo 2.
When it all started:
Driving very hard through contry lanes other night running perfect, left the lanes and got on a motorway pulling about 3000rpm in 5th gear floored it and didn't accelerate. Made lots of noise, boost went up to pressure, but stayed at same speed. Then the rough running became very aparent. So the problem seems to come on in an instant not over the course of a prelonged period
The symptoms:
-Very rough idle
-No power under 3500rpm, hard to pull away and highs gears useless if under these revs.
-Under 3500rpm backfires, spluters, coughs.
- Once above 3500rpm drives normal, responds as it should with all the normal power.
What ive checked:
- Spark plugs, only 6,000 miles old, not brilliant shape but not the worst i've seen.
- HT leads perfect condition 200miles old 10mm items
- coils producing spark
- engine compression tested using normal guage, consistant bonces of 70 psi on each chamber.
- Only quick visual check of vacuum lines.
Things I've thought about but not checked or don't have the kit to check:
- Throttle position sensor
- Timing and timing advance
So what do you guys think? the car is my daily drive and my bicycle is hard work!

Did you remove the valve in the compression gauge? That causes the compression to read the same on all rotor faces. Removing it allows you to see the individual compression numbers. 70psi does sound low though... It sounds as though you have a cracked/chipped apex seal.

Uhhhh, shouldn't it be obvious?
You probably have a primary injector clogged or going bad. Secondaries come on, around 3500rpm.
Also, the standard compression testers usually arent all that accurate anyway.
Try switching the secondary and primary injectors, use new o-rings, if it idles fine, then get the injectors, now in the secondary position, cleaned and flow tested. Hopefully you wont need new ones.
Also, do not hammer on the car anymore in this state.

I had exactly the same symptoms on my 88 NA last summer. Took the car out for a late night cruise on some twisties the when I rolled back into town I stopped to pick up some snacks. Got back in the car to head home and it ran like Sh*t up to around 3500 rpm. Over 3500 was ok. I figured vac leak or something goofy. Turned to be one defective primary injector. Over 3500 rpm the secondaries kick in so that's why it clears up the roughness.
Motor had about 500 miles since a complete rebuild with new housings. I assumed the injectors were ok and put them back in after the rebuild.
Big mistake, I should have sprung for rebuilts and saved myself a days worth of work.
Got rebuilts from Rock Auto. about 45$ each and you get 10$ each when you return the cores.
Motor runs better than ever now.
